Diamond solitaires, such as the Sabatina, are a traditional choice for engagement rings and the square shape of the princess cut diamond has become a popular alternative to the round brilliant stone. There are several good reasons for this. Firstly, princess cut diamonds have more "fire" than most diamond cuts, meaning that they more brilliant and have more sparkle.
The second advantage of the princess cut is that it makes inclusions, or flaws, less visible and any slight yellowish or brownish colour less noticeable, which means that the buyer gets a more attractive diamond at a more reasonable price.

For this price, your diamond will be graded I on the colour scale, meaning that it is near colourless; and SI2 on the clarity scale, which means the diamond will be only slightly included.
Let's consider the issue of clarity in more detail. Diamonds of the same size will vary dramatically in price if they are of differing quality. A perfectly flawless diamond is extremely rare and therefore incredibly expensive. Diamonds rated SI will not be flawless but a jeweller's loupe would be required to spot the inclusions (flaws), and very few would actually be visible to the naked eye. 1791 Diamonds only use high quality diamonds for their engagement rings so you can be assured that your Sabatina princess diamond solitaire engagement ring will be stunning.
